Alternative Medicine in Natick, MA

310 Eliot St, Natick, Massachusetts, 01760-5513

(508) 650-1777


6 Union Ave, Natick, Massachusetts, 01760

(508) 655-7070


218 N Main St, Natick, Massachusetts, 01760-1139

(508) 647-4955


83 Speen St, Natick, Massachusetts, 01760-4168

(508) 907-6543


12 W Central St, Natick, Massachusetts, 01760-4591

(508) 653-8685


67 Union St, Natick, Massachusetts, 01760-7700

(781) 235-4073


67 Union St, Natick, Massachusetts, 01760-7700

(508) 651-1998


83 Speen St, Natick, Massachusetts, 01760-4168

(508) 907-6544


67 Union St, Natick, Massachusetts, 01760-7700

(508) 653-4400